Mission Hill (1999–2002)
Very good show
29 July 2002
When I first saw "Mission Hill" on Cartoon Network, I was very impressed. At first it had seemed like it'd be one of those generic animated comedies that have about 2-3 funny moments each show (Unfortunately, "South Park" seems to be headed down this path), but "Mission Hill" is one of the few recent cartoon comedies that is consistently funny. And it's not as if it's only funny when it has to be funny. There is a lot of humor that is more subtle, and there's also a lot of humor in the background of the show that one would only notice by paying full attention. The only problem with this show is that it's currently only on latenight on Sunday.

Clerks (2000–2001)
Did not deserve to get cancelled
30 July 2000
I couldn't believe my eyes when I read that the amazing movie "Clerks" was being made into a cartoon TV series. I immediately sent an e-mail to my sister about it, and couldn't wait to watch the show. The day finally came around and I was not too disappointed. It was a great show. A week later, I saw the second episode, which was even better. Then, a week later, I went to watch it, only to find a rerun of Spin City. This amazing show had been cancelled after two episodes. It's almost as if ABC wanted it to get cancelled immediately. They barely even advertised.

Well, at least the six episodes that were made are coming out on VHS/DVD.
